Home

Page 206
Page 206
background image

Простые приемы работы с сетью

199

4.12. Простейший TELNET-клиент

Теперь я хочу показать вам, как можно написать простейшего Telnet-

клиента. С помощью такого клиента можно подключится к какому-нибудь

серверному порту и выполнять команды прямо на сервере. Например, если
подключиться к порту Telnet, то можно запускать на сервере программы.

Если подключится к порту FTP, то можно выполнять команды FTP из ко-
мандной строки.

Для тестирования нашего Telnet-клиента я буду использовать подключение

к локальному

 который входит в поставку Windows 2000 и

Windows

 В старых версиях Windows 9x можно использовать Personal

WEB Server, который отличается только настройками и меньшим количест-

вом возможностей. Но об этом чуть позже.
Итак, создаем новый проект и делаем форму похожей на изображение на

рис. 4.42. Здесь находится две строки ввода: для ввода IP-адреса сервера,

к которому мы хотим подключиться, и для ввода номера порта, который
надо использовать. В единственном выпадающем списке

 можно

выбирать тип используемого терминала.

/ Telnet

Connect 1

 4.42. Форма будущей программы

Помимо этого нам понадобятся две кнопки: Connect и Disconnect для под-
ключения и отключения от сервера. И один компонент

 в котором мы

будем набирать команды, отправляемые серверу, и отображать результат вы-

полнения команд.
Самым основным компонентом будет

 с закладки

 Clients

палитры компонентов. Его нужно просто перенести на форму, все его свой-
ства оставим заданными по умолчанию.


Copyright © 2020 Файлообменник files.d-lan.dp.ua

Использование любых материалов сайта возможно только с разрешения автора.